Transaction 21678dff0c96886f7663016b64515f405382655e5b30f93b05101be4ae8fa638

1 Input
2 Outputs
  • 21678dff0c96886f7663016b64515f405382655e5b30f93b05101be4ae8fa638:0
  • value  17516880
    address  17Z5egAFCMm5C2jzZrUYXQY4w6DQdkp9m4
  • 21678dff0c96886f7663016b64515f405382655e5b30f93b05101be4ae8fa638:1
  • value  52727583
    address  1LK8SpfLRzLcBqA1KwviRnKX9orPXUjSg7